Chengbin Ma is affiliated with Shanghai Jiao Tong University in China, contributing extensively to the field of engineering with a focus on electrical and electronic engineering. Their research encompasses a range of interconnected domains, addressing technological advancements and system innovations in energy and mobility sectors.
